God is Moving in Beirut - a Report from the Field

• Through the reading of a Bible given by one of our team members, N. found God. Not only that, she now states that she is a messenger for Jesus and has a passion for others to know Him. She is being discipled as she continues to grow in her "new found" faith.

• S., an elderly Muslim lady, sat in her apartment and prayed for a Bible. Shortly after this, one of our team members showed up at her apartment with the gift of God's Word. S. told our team member how she believes the Jesus is the Son of God and that the Bible is true. Today, S. is studying the Scriptures and talking about what she is learning.

• During the Lebanese Missions Conference, many people committed to being more involved in taking God’s renown all throughout the Middle East and North Africa.

• During Ramadan (the month of fasting and seeking God), a lady asked a team member if she could explain more to her about the story of Jesus because she wants to know “this God.”

• A young girl had a dream in which God told her that a woman would come to her. The next day, a team member showed up and as the answer to the dream. Today, that team member is sharing the love of Jesus and the Gospel with the girl’s whole family.

• Through one of the volunteer groups that came to Beirut, one of our team members met K. who had come to faith in Christ. The team member had been meeting with K. to disciple her. Just the other day, K. took a bold stand and shared publicly with her whole class at her Muslim University that she is a follower of Jesus Christ. This led to the opportunity for her to share the truth that is only found in Jesus.

These are only a few of the many accounts of God's working in Beirut. I wish that I had the time and space to share with you everything that God is doing in Beirut. He truly is doing more than we could ever imagine or dream.
